MG4 is a machine gun in CrossFire.
Overview[]
MG4 is a machine gun that has a longer barrel than M249 Minimi and an optical scope. Unlike the M16A3 LMG, this weapon's scope is the optical zoom instead of a red dot sight, which does not decrease the firing rate but is more accurate.
This gun features a standard 100 rounds magazine (100 in reserve), with good firepower and accuracy but suffer from high recoil due to the fast firing rate. It is medium-weight and draws out quite fast, but has a very slow reload-speed.

Trivia[]
- CrossFire Vietnam originally promoted this gun under the name MG4 Perspective, but by the time it was added, the correct name MG4 is used.
- MG4's animation was heavily recycled for a lot of new machine guns in CrossFire.
- Starting with Vektor SS-77, CETME Ameli, KSP 58D and Negev NG7.
- Some minor edits were made to accomondate to some machine guns as well, such as PKP 6P41 Pecheneg, SIG MG 710-3, M240B, LSAT and AEK-999.
- This gun was supposed to be added to CrossFire Vietnam as of May 2013 patch, but it was replaced by the MG3-Camo for some reason. It was later added at July 2013 patch, 2 months later than when it was first revealed.
